#dc1e01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c1e01 is composed of 86.3% red, 11.8%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.4% magenta, 99.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 7.9 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 43.3%. #dc1e01 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3c02 with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#dc1e01 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c1e01 has RGB values of R:220, G:30,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:1,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14425601.

Shades and Tints of #dc1e01
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050100 is the darkest color, while #fff3f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c1e01
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766967 is the less saturated color, while #dc1e01 is the most saturated one.
